Job Summary:
We are seeking a skilled and experienced Business Analyst to support our clients. This role involves gathering requirements from internal teams and field personnel, translating those needs into actionable insights for development teams, and creating clear, engaging documentation and training materials. The ideal candidate will be comfortable interfacing with a variety of stakeholders, from linemen and field crews to developers and leadership, and will have a knack for turning complex technical information into user-friendly content.
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ct meetings with internal teams, field crews, and linemen to gather business and technical requirements.
- Translate field and business needs into functional specifications for development teams.
- Collaborate with developers to ensure systems meet user requirements.
- Create and maintain technical documentation, training guides, and user manuals.
- Develop marketing materials and presentations to support internal and external communications.
- Present findings, documentation, and training to stakeholders in a clear and engaging manner.
- Ensure consistency and clarity across all written materials.
- 5-10 years of experience in technical writing, business analysis, or a related field.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ills, especially in virtual environments.
- Ability to simplify complex technical concepts for non-technical audiences.
- Proficiency in documentation tools (e.g., Microsoft Office, Adobe, Confluence, etc.).
- Familiarity with utility or power delivery environments is a plus.
